Some Chemical Engineering books you can refer to complete your course syllabus are

  • Chemical Reaction Engineering by Octave Levenspiel
  • Chemical Process Safety: Fundamentals with Applications by Joseph F. Louvar and Daniel A. Crowl
  • Biochemical Engineering Fundamentals by J. E. Bailey and D. F. Ollis
  • Unit Operations of Chemical Engineering by Warren L. McCabe and Julian C. Smith
  • Chemical Engineering Thermodynamics – Theory and Applications by R. Ravi

The level wise Chemical Engineering salary in India differs on the basis of experience, job role, recruiter, company location and skill set.

As a college fresher you can easily earn around INR 4 LPA to INR 6 LPA while mid-level Chemical Engineering job profiles like Project Manager or Quality Control Executive make around INR 7 LPA to INR 10 LPA. After you've got years of experience in the in dustry and are promoted to senior-level jobs your earning potential will increase to around INR 10 LPA and above.

The latest GATE 2026 exam update as per the conducting authorities are as follows -

1. The GATE 2026 application fee have been revised, which is as follows -

Category

GATE 2026 application form fees during the regular period

GATE 2026 application form submission fees during the extended period

Female/ST/SC/PwD category

INR 1000

INR 1500

Other candidates

INR 2000

INR 2000

2. A new GATE paper have been introduced under GATE Engineering Sciences (XE) called Energy Science. The GATE paper code of Energy Science is XE (I). Candidates who want to pursue careers in sustainable energy resources, solar powers, green technologies can look out for this subject.
